Customizing Dashboards with Next.js: Benefits and Advantages

Next.js, a popular React framework, offers powerful tools and features that enable developers to build highly customizable dashboards tailored to specific needs. Here, we explore the key benefits of using Next.js for creating customizable dashboards.

Vahid Takro04 Sep 2025
Next.js
Web Development
Languages:

In today's data-driven world, having a personalized and efficient dashboard is essential for businesses and individuals alike. Next.js, a popular React framework, offers powerful tools and features that enable developers to build highly customizable dashboards tailored to specific needs. Here, we explore the key benefits of using Next.js for creating customizable dashboards.

1. Seamless Server-Side Rendering and Static Generation

Next.js provides built-in support for server-side rendering (SSR) and static site generation (SSG), allowing dashboards to load rapidly and perform efficiently. This means users experience faster load times and improved performance, especially when handling large datasets or complex visualizations.

2. Enhanced Performance and Optimization

Next.js automatically optimizes assets, code splitting, and lazy loading. These features ensure that only necessary components are loaded initially, reducing load times and enhancing overall responsiveness of the dashboard.

3. Flexibility in Customization

With Next.js, developers can easily build highly customizable dashboards by integrating various data sources, visualization libraries, and UI components. This flexibility allows for tailored layouts, widgets, and interactive features that meet unique user requirements.

4. Improved Developer Experience

Next.js offers a streamlined development process with features like hot module replacement, an intuitive API, and extensive documentation. This accelerates development cycles and makes it easier to implement complex customization features without excessive overhead.

5. Scalability and Maintainability

Built on React, Next.js promotes component-based architecture, making dashboards easier to scale and maintain. Developers can create reusable components, manage state efficiently, and update features seamlessly as requirements evolve.

6. SEO Benefits

Since dashboards can be optimized for search engines through SSR, Next.js helps ensure that important pages and data visualizations are discoverable, increasing visibility and accessibility for users and stakeholders.

7. Enhanced Security and Authentication

Next.js integrates well with authentication solutions, enabling secure access to sensitive data within dashboards. Custom access controls can be implemented to ensure that only authorized users view or modify specific information.

Using Next.js to build customizable dashboards offers numerous benefits, including improved performance, flexibility, scalability, and a better user experience. Its powerful features make it an excellent choice for creating dynamic, personalized, and efficient dashboards that adapt to evolving business needs and user preferences.

TAGS

Development
Technology
Design
SHARE

COMMENTS

No Comments Yet

Be the first to share your thoughts on this post!

LEAVE A COMMENT

Related Articles
No Related Articles

There are no related articles available in this language.